#TestIt Alert: Light pink Superman tablet sold in San Antonio, TX as MDMA but actually contains caffeine and methamphetamine

By: Rachel Clark, DanceSafe Contractor A light pink Superman logo-shaped tablet with a score line on the back was sold in San Antonio, TX as MDMA but actually contains 2 parts caffeine and 1 part methamphetamine. The sample was both sourced and sold in San Antonio, TX.  The sample turned orange to brown in the presence of the Marquis reagent, yellow with the Mecke reagent, and yellow-green with the Mandelin reagent.  MDMA, while a stimulant by nature, does not have drastic stimulating effects on the central nervous system in the same way that caffeine and methamphetamine do. #TestIt Alert: Clear capsule of brown powder sold in San Diego, CA as MDMA but actually contains caffeine, lidocaine, MDPV, and 5-MeO-DALT 

By: Rachel Clark, DanceSafe Contractor A clear capsule containing a brown powder was sold in San Diego, CA as MDMA but actually contained 5 parts caffeine, 2 parts lidocaine, 1 part MDPV, and 1 part 5-MeO-DALT. The sender noted that it has a very strong, odd smell.
